Macular Degeneration and Vision Protection
The American Academy of Ophthalmology recommends that if you have intermediate or advanced dry macular degeneration in one eye only, you should talk with your physician about whether nutritional supplements may help you. If supplements are recommended, your physician can also tell you how to take them safely (see Vitamins for Macular Degeneration). Not everyone needs macular degeneration supplements. For example, in large quantities, zinc can be toxic, and beta-carotene can increase the risk of lung cancer in smokers. High-dose nutrients can also interfere with medications and can decrease the absorption of other nutrients into the body.
